Abstract

PURPOSE:To obtain a resin molded article having soft luster, absorptivity, nonelectrification and enriched with water resistance, durability, fungus resistance or the like by mixing at a specific percent by weight animal bristle powders into a synthetic resin material. CONSTITUTION:Animal bristle powders is mixed at 10-80% by weight into a synthetic resin material, and then made into pellets. The bristle powders are rod-shaped ones microscopically in its granular configurations, and as dispersed into the resin, they interwine with one another like as net meshes and the resin is stretched around the net meshes like rods, as a result, the resin layer becomes hard to be discontinuous and even the mixed rate of the bristle powders is made much, the rate of frailty is less. Namely, when a molded article is manufactured by the use of pellets in which animal bristle powders are mixed with synthetic resin, the bristle powders may not be condensed and distributed in the molded article in a state of being dispersed uniformly. The molded article manufactured with the pellets has excellent solidity, soft feelings and senses, calm color tone and becomes excellent in its electrostatic resistance, moisture permeability or the like.

[Detailed Description of the Invention] (Industrial Application Field) The present invention provides a resin molded product that has a soft gloss, moisture permeability, water absorption, and non-static properties, and is highly water resistant, durable, and antibacterial. This relates to pellets for forming products.

(Conventional Techniques i, iI) In the case of molded products using only synthetic 11H material, the gloss is not deep and the functionality, that is, hygroscopicity is low, resulting in frequent troughs due to excessive static electricity. ing.

In order to compensate for this drawback, various materials are used as fillers for resin. In addition, in response to the recent trend toward luxury, molded products with static electricity resistance, moisture permeability, water absorption, etc., are required, and have a soft luster and a calm color tone. Attempts have been made to mix leather powder into synthetic resin, and molding pellets have been made for this purpose.

(Unexamined Japanese Patent Publication No. 63-11311) <Problems to be Solved by the Invention> However, conventional molding pellets are still insufficient in terms of color tone, moisture permeability, water absorption, non-static properties, antibacterial properties, and durability. It wasn't.

(Means for Solving the Problems) The characteristic means of the present invention is to mix 10 to 80% by weight of animal hair powder into a synthetic resin material and form it into a pellet.The effect is as follows. It is.

(Function) For example, resin pellets mixed with leather powder have a calm color tone, and have good static resistance, moisture permeability, and water absorption.
If you try to mix in leather powder until it develops characteristics such as Jilt, you will have to increase the amount to achieve it, but if you increase the amount of leather powder mixed in, there is a problem that the strength of the resin will weaken.
As a result, the strength of the molded product decreases and its commercial value decreases. Therefore, there was naturally a limit to increasing the amount of leather powder mixed in. The particle shape of hair powder is microscopically rod-shaped, and when dispersed in resin, they intertwine like a net, and the resin is spread like a film around the mesh, making the resin layer discontinuous. Therefore, even if the amount of hair powder mixed in is increased, the percentage of brittleness is small. In other words, when a molded product is made using a beret made of animal hair powder mixed with synthetic resin according to the present invention,
The hair powder is distributed in a uniformly dispersed state throughout the molded product without agglomeration. Therefore, molded products manufactured using this pellet have excellent fastness, a soft feel, and a calm color tone, and are also excellent in static electricity resistance, moisture permeability, water absorption, etc. Furthermore, the feel, color tone, static resistance, moisture permeability, water absorption, etc. can be freely changed by changing the mixing ratio of hair powder. In other words, the greater the amount of hair mixed in, the stronger the characteristics of the hair will appear, making it more flexible, warmer to the touch, and deeper in color.Furthermore, it has non-static properties, moisture permeability, water absorption, It also gets better.

The carbonized wool (d) was put into a pressure vessel with a heating jacket, and 3 kg/cj of steam was supplied into the vessel and the jacket at the same time. First, the air in the vessel was replaced with steam, and then the vessel was sealed and heated for about 10 minutes. Heated for a minute. After the hair tissue was sufficiently swollen in this manner, the outlet of the pressure vessel was opened all at once to cause swelling due to rapid pressure reduction. This was dried until the moisture content was around 10%, then crushed with an impact crusher and classified to obtain an average particle size of 30μ.
A pellet was made by mixing and kneading 30% of m wool powder and 70% of polyethylene resin mixed with a plasticizer.
